What Is Illinois Shines and
How Do SRECs Work?
The Illinois Shines program was created to support the state’s transition to renewable energy by providing financial incentives to solar system owners. When a solar system generates energy, it also creates Solar Renewable Energy Credits (SRECs), which represent the environmental value of energy generated by solar renewable energy.
Through Illinois Shines, solar system owners receive incentive payments for the SRECS their systems produce. These payments are made to Approved Vendors like Acorn Management Group #856, who have been authorized by the Illinois Power Agency (IPA) to submit projects into the program, and then the savings are passed on to customers. Only Approved Vendors are qualified to submit applications for incentives to the Illinois Shines program. Illinois Shines SREC Process
Leave it to Acorn Management Group to handle all the details for each of the three steps in the Illinois Shines process:
STEP 1
Disclosure Form and
Contract Signing
The first step is completing a state-generated disclosure form that verifies that the system you purchase matches what is installed. Once that has been signed, you can sign the installation contract.
STEP 2
Part One Application
Next, the Part One Application is completed and submitted to the state of Illinois. This application includes a detailed site map of your solar system as well as a signed REC Purchase Agreement, which authorizes Acorn Management Group to broker the sale of your SRECs to the contracting utility.
Once Part One is verified, your project briefly enters a holding period while waiting for batch approval from the Illinois Commerce Commission (ICC). After the ICC approval, we submit required proof of irrevocable transfer, preparing your project for the final stage.
STEP 3
Part Two Application
The final step is the Part Two Application, when Acorn Management Group uploads detailed photos of your installation – including panels, meters, and inverters – as well as the Certificate of Completion from the utility. Illinois Shines carefully checks this information against the program application and the PJM-EIS GATS (a renewable energy tracking system) registry.
After verification, your system is fully approved and SREC payments are scheduled for disbursement. Payments are issued on the last business day of the month in which the invoice was submitted. After the initial SREC sale, Acorn Management Group continues to upload your system’s monthly energy generation data into PJM-EIS GATS, ensuring the proper transfer of RECs throughout the eligible lifespan of the system.
